WASHINGTON (AP) — The Department of Energy said Thursday it has finalized a $1.6 billion loan guarantee to a subsidiary of one of the nation’s largest power companies to upgrade nearly 5,000 miles of transmission lines across five states, mostly in the Midwest, for largely fossil fuel-run energy. AEP Transmission will upgrade power lines in Indiana, Michigan, Ohio, Oklahoma and West Virginia, primarily to enhance enhance grid reliability and capacity, the Energy Department said. As entertaining as it’s been for the tech industry to watch rival payroll decacorns Deel and Rippling sue each other over a corporate spying scandal, top-tier VCs are apparently not terribly scared off. Deel on Thursday announced that it has raised a $300 million Series E round co-led by A-list fintech VC firm Ribbit Capital and Andreessen Horowitz, with participation from existing investors like Coatue Management and General Catalyst. Coinbase has increased its investment in India’s CoinDCX, valuing the exchange at $2.45 billion post-money, as the U.S. crypto giant bets on the country’s digital-asset potential even as regulation remains unclear. The investment is an extension of CoinDCX’s previous funding round and is subject to regulatory approvals and customary closing conditions, the companies said on Wednesday. They did not disclose the amount invested or the size of Coinbase’s stake, but noted that the new round increased the Indian exchange’s valuation from $2.15 billion in its last raise in April 2022.
